What is a Medical License?

A medical license is an occupational permit that licenses a health care professional to practice medication within a specific jurisdiction. It is given by a government-appointed board after the prospect has offered proof of their education, training, and proficiency. Its main function is to safeguard the general public from unskilled or unethical specialists.

In the United States, medical licenses are approved by state medical boards. While the administrative costs for these licenses can be considerable, the "purchase" cost is actually an application and processing charge, not a payment for the credential itself.

The Legitimate Path to Licensure

For those interested in the profession, the path is long however structured. The following list describes the necessary actions taken by every legitimate physician in the United States.

List: The 6-Step Licensing Process

  1. Undergraduate Education: Completion of a Bachelor's degree, generally focusing on pre-medical sciences.
  2. Medical Degree (MD or DO): Completion of 4 years at an accredited medical school.
  3. Postgraduate Training (Residency): A minimum of one to three years (depending upon the state) of supervised training in a healthcare facility environment.
  4. Standardized Examinations: Passing all three steps of the United States Medical Licensing Examination (USMLE) or the Comprehensive Osteopathic Medical Licensing Examination (COMLEX-USA).
  5. Credential Verification: Verification of all educational and training files through services like the Federation of State Medical Boards (FSMB).
  6. State Board Approval: A final evaluation by a state medical board, including a principles examine and criminal background screening.

Verification Systems: Why Shortcuts Don't Work

Modern health care systems use sophisticated databases to ensure every professional is genuine. This makes "purchased" files obsolete extremely quickly.

Table 2: Verification Systems and Their Roles

SystemRoleWho Uses It?
NPDBNational Practitioner Data Bank - tracks malpractice and disciplinary actions.Health Centers and Insurance Companies.
AMA Physician MasterfileA comprehensive database of all MDs/DOs in the US.Scientists and Credentialing bodies.
NPI RegistryNational Provider Identifier required for billing.CMS (Medicare/Medicaid) and Pharmacies.
FSMB (PDC)Physician Data Center-- tracks licensing status throughout all states.State Medical Boards.

When a medical professional requests a task at a health center or attempts to bill an insurer, their information is cross-referenced versus these databases. If a "purchased" license does not exist in these main systems, the scams is immediately detected.
